In the fast-moving world of mobile apps, staying ahead of the competition isn’t just about having a great idea—it’s about execution. If your mobile app development team is stretched thin, missing deadlines, or struggling to keep up with new technologies, it might be time to rethink your approach. But how do you know when expansion is the right move? Let’s break it down.
The Signs You Need to Scale Up
1. Deadlines Keep Slipping
You started with a solid roadmap, but things aren’t going as planned. Missed deadlines are more than just an inconvenience—they’re a warning sign. If your team is consistently running behind, it could indicate that they’re overwhelmed, lacking specialized skills, or simply outnumbered by the demands of the project.
2. Innovation is Taking a Backseat
Your competitors are launching cutting-edge features, but your team is still patching bugs. When innovation takes a backseat to maintenance and troubleshooting, it’s a clear signal that your development resources are stretched too thin. A larger team can help balance the workload and keep your app on the forefront of technological advancements.
3. User Experience is Suffering
Have you noticed an increase in user complaints? Are ratings dipping? These are red flags that shouldn’t be ignored. A smaller team may struggle to address bugs, optimize performance, and introduce necessary improvements in a timely manner. A robust development team ensures a smoother, more responsive user experience.
4. Your Business is Growing Faster Than Your Team
Scaling a business without scaling your development team is a recipe for disaster. If your user base is expanding, but your app infrastructure isn’t keeping up, you’re inviting performance issues and frustrated customers. A growing business needs a development team that can keep pace.
When Expansion Makes Sense
1. You Need Specialized Expertise
Mobile app development isn’t a one-size-fits-all process. Whether it’s AI, augmented reality, blockchain, or advanced security features, hiring specialists can take your app to the next level. If your current team lacks the expertise for a key feature, expansion is the logical next step.
2. Your In-House Team is Overwhelmed
Burnout is real. If your developers are constantly working late nights, fixing bugs instead of focusing on new features, or struggling to balance multiple projects, it’s time to relieve the pressure. Expanding your team can improve efficiency and morale.
3. You Want to Speed Up Development
Time-to-market is critical. A lean team might be cost-effective, but it also means slower development cycles. If you’re losing ground to competitors due to long development timelines, adding more developers can accelerate the process without sacrificing quality.
How to Expand Your Development Team Smartly
1. Decide Between In-House and Outsourcing
Building an in-house team offers more control but requires significant investment in hiring, training, and infrastructure. On the other hand, outsourcing gives you access to a global talent pool, often at a lower cost. The key is to find the right balance based on your business needs.
2. Hire Developers Who Fit Your Vision
Technical skills are critical, but cultural fit matters too. Your new team members should align with your company’s goals, communication style, and work ethic. A cohesive team is far more productive than a group of highly skilled individuals who don’t work well together.
3. Prioritize Agile Development
An agile development approach allows you to scale efficiently. By working in sprints, setting clear priorities, and continuously iterating based on feedback, you can manage a larger team without losing agility.
4. Invest in Collaboration Tools
As your team expands, communication can become a challenge. Invest in project management tools like Jira, Trello, or Asana to keep everyone on the same page. Clear documentation and streamlined workflows prevent bottlenecks and miscommunication.
The Risks of Not Scaling
Ignoring the signs that your team needs expansion can have serious consequences. You risk losing customers to better-performing competitors, overworking your existing team to the point of burnout, and delaying crucial updates that keep your app relevant. Expanding strategically is about ensuring long-term success, not just solving immediate problems.
Conclusion
Recognizing when to scale your mobile app development team is crucial for sustained success. Whether it’s to meet growing demand, incorporate new technologies, or enhance user experience, the right expansion strategy can set your app up for long-term growth. If you’re looking for skilled mobile app developers Atlanta to help you scale efficiently, now is the time to make your move.